Name and origin of the protein
Protein name Abscisic acid 8'-hydroxylase 1
Synonyms ABA 8'-hydroxylase 1
EC 1.14.13.93
OsABA8ox1
Cytochrome P450 707A5
Gene name
Name: CYP707A5
Synonyms: ABA8OX1
OrderedLocusNames: Os02g0703600, LOC_Os02g47470
ORFNames: OJ1218_D07.28, P0724B10.17, OsJ_007800
From
Oryza sativa subsp. japonica (Rice) [TaxID: 39947] 
Taxonomy Eukaryota; Viridiplantae; Streptophyta; Embryophyta; Tracheophyta; Spermatophyta; Magnoliophyta; Liliopsida; Poales; Poaceae; BEP clade; Ehrhartoideae; Oryzeae; Oryza.
Protein existence 2: Evidence at transcript level;
